Annual Report: TDF’s infrastructure in 2021

In 2021, the infrastructure team migrated our “Ask LibreOffice” site to Discourse, deployed a Decidim instance, and assisted with video streaming during the LibreOffice Conference.

(This is part of The Document Foundation’s Annual Report for 2021 – we’ll post the full version here soon.)

LibreOffice’s infrastructure team is responsible for maintaining the hardware, virtual machines and services that enable the wider community to develop, market, test, localize and improve the software. The public infrastructure is powered by around 50 kernel-based virtual machines (KVMs) spread across four hypervisors, plugged to an internal 10Gbps switch, hosted at Manitu in St. Wendel (Germany), and managed with libvirt and its KVM/QEMU driver. The virtual disk images are typically stored in GlusterFS volumes – distributed across the hypervisors – except for some transient disks (such as cache) where the IOPS requirement is higher and the redundancy less important.

As 2021 marked another “pandemic year” with only online events, the infrastructure team helped to make these a pleasant experience from home. Notably, they deployed a Pretalx instance to manage conference submissions and the schedule, and put in place a streaming backend based on Jitsi/Jibri/RTMP during the annual conference, thereby providing several participation options to chose from.

Ask LibreOffice

After several months of tests and feedback from the community, the infra team also concluded the migration of LibreOffice’s Q&A platform (“Ask LibreOffice”) to Discourse. Over 65,000 questions and 130,000 replies from 50,000 users — spanning over 17 languages — were imported, with a focus on preserving post attribution and overall layout. The metric collection engines (Matomo as well as the public Grimoire Dashboard) were updated to reflect that change.

Also on the community participation front, the infrastructure team deployed a Decidim instance to structure debate and encourage democratic participation from community members. The instance is currently still under test.

On the Continuous Integration (CI) front, the team deployed new buildbots for Windows and Linux baselines, as well as a buildbot for the WebAssembly (WASM) effort. They also migrated and refactored the bibisect setup to better suit the needs of the quality assurance community.

Backends

As for the backends: Debian GNU/Linux 11 (codename “Bullseye”) was released in the middle of 2021, and the team upgraded most of TDF’s virtual machines accordingly during the second half of the year. However, for the lower layers of the virtualization stack, the upgrade is planned for 2022. Furthermore, lots of work was done in planning the restructuring of database engines, most notably around Point-in-Time Recovery; this work was driven by contributor Brett Cornwall. Finally, the team assisted the Membership Committee with the architecture of the back-end side of their new tooling.

Like what we do? Support the LibreOffice project and The Document Foundation – get involved and help our volunteers, or consider making a donation. Thank you!

Announcement of LibreOffice 7.2.7 Community

Berlin, May 12, 2022 – LibreOffice 7.2.7 Community, the seventh minor release of the LibreOffice 7.2 family, targeted at desktop productivity, is available for download from https://www.libreoffice.org/download/.

End user support is provided by volunteers via email and online resources: https://www.libreoffice.org/get-help/community-support/. On the website and the wiki there are guides, manuals, tutorials and HowTos. Donations help us to make all of these resources available.

For enterprise-class deployments, TDF strongly recommends the LibreOffice Enterprise family of applications from ecosystem partners, with long-term support options, professional assistance, custom features and Service Level Agreements: https://www.libreoffice.org/download/libreoffice-in-business/.

LibreOffice 7.2.7’s changelog pages are available on TDF’s wiki: https://wiki.documentfoundation.org/Releases/7.2.7/RC1 (changed in RC1) and https://wiki.documentfoundation.org/Releases/7.2.7/RC2 (changed in RC2).

LibreOffice Community and the LibreOffice Enterprise family of products are based on the LibreOffice Technology platform, the result of years of development efforts with the objective of providing a state of the art office suite not only for the desktop but also for mobile and the cloud.

LibreOffice Technology based products for Android and iOS are listed here: https://www.libreoffice.org/download/android-and-ios/, while for App Stores and ChromeOS are listed here: https://www.libreoffice.org/download/libreoffice-from-microsoft-and-mac-app-stores/

LibreOffice users, free software advocates and community members can provide financial support to The Document Foundation with a donation via PayPal, credit card or other tools at https://www.libreoffice.org/donate.

LibreOffice 7.2.7 is built with document conversion libraries from the Document Liberation Project: https://www.documentliberation.org.

Czech translation of LibreOffice Getting Started Guide 7.3

Zdeněk Crhonek (aka “raal”) from the Czech LibreOffice community writes:

The Czech team has finished its translation of the LibreOffice Getting Started Guide 7.3. As usual it was team work, namely: translations by Petr Kuběj, Zdeněk Crhonek and Ludmila Chládková; localized pictures by Roman Toman; and technical support from Miloš Šrámek. Thanks to all the team for their work! The Czech translation of the guide 7.3 is available for download on this page.

Indeed, many thanks to everyone in the Czech community for their work! Learn more about LibreOffice’s documentation project here.

Annual Report: LibreOffice Quality Assurance in 2021

Quality Assurance (QA) is a cornerstone of the LibreOffice project, thanks to the activity of a large number of volunteers and the feedback of many users who help in reporting bugs and regressions.

(This is part of The Document Foundation’s Annual Report for 2021 – we’ll post the full version here soon.)

In 2021, the QA team triaged thousands of bugs, bisected hundreds of regressions, and answered questions from countless bug reporters. As one of the most visible groups directly responding to end users, the QA team must be nimble and able to adapt to changes. In addition, it must deal with specific requests for help from other teams.

The QA team meets regularly on IRC on the #libreoffice-qa channel, which is the best medium for discussing bugs and regressions. The IRC channel provides an excellent opportunity to remain in close contact with team members, and to tutor new members in the art and skill of LibreOffice QA. This is bridged to the Telegram group.

During 2021, 6,804 bugs were reported by 3,022 users, which means 131 new bugs were reported every week on average.

Top 10 bug reporters

  • Telesto (571)
  • NISZ LibreOffice Team (296)
  • Regina Henschel (126)
  • Mike Kaganski (115)
  • Xisco Faulí (104)
  • Eyal Rozenberg (87)
  • Rafael Lima (66)
  • sdc.blanco (60)
  • Valek Filippov (54)
  • Colin (50)

Bug Hunting, Bibisecting

In July 2021, the QA Team organized an online Bug Hunting Session for LibreOffice 7.2. This provided the opportunity for all users, especially those with technical knowledge, to test pre-release versions and provide their feedback in the IRC channel and Telegram group. They were helped to report and confirm bugs, which led to improved stability in the final release.

Also, during 2021, the QA team performed 652 bibisects of regressions.

Top 10 Bisecters

  • Xisco Faulí (166)
  • Timur (85)
  • Aron Budea (68)
  • raal (66)
  • Buovjaga (48)
  • Telesto (46)
  • NISZ LibreOffice Team (29)
  • Justin L (23)
  • Roman Kuznetsov (23)
  • Kevin Suo (18)

Learn more about the QA project on this page, and give the team a hand!

Like what we do? Support the LibreOffice project and The Document Foundation – get involved and help our volunteers, or consider making a donation. Thank you!

LibreOffice 7.3.3 Community available for download

LibreOffice is now available for download also on SourceForge

Berlin, May 4, 2022 – LibreOffice 7.3.3 Community, the third minor release of the LibreOffice 7.3 family, targeted at technology enthusiasts and power users, is available for download from https://www.libreoffice.org/download/. In addition to the LibreOffice website, starting from tomorrow it will be possible to download LibreOffice from SourceForge: https://sourceforge.net/projects/libreoffice/files/libreoffice/stable/.

Logan Abbott, SourceForge’s President and COO, says: “We’re happy to add to our open source download library an amazing open source office suite such as LibreOffice, which is without a doubt one of the best office suites ever and one which I personally use often. I highly recommend it to anyone that needs a powerful FOSS office suite.”

The LibreOffice 7.3 family offers the highest level of compatibility in the office suite market segment, starting with native support for the OpenDocument Format (ODF) – beating proprietary formats in the areas of security and robustness – to superior support for DOCX, XLSX and PPTX files.

Microsoft files are still based on the proprietary format deprecated by ISO in 2008, which is artificially complex, and not on the ISO approved standard. This lack of respect for the ISO standard format may create issues to LibreOffice, and is a huge obstacle for transparent interoperability.

LibreOffice for enterprise deployments

For enterprise-class deployments, TDF strongly recommends the LibreOffice Enterprise family of applications from ecosystem partners, with long-term support options, professional assistance, custom features and Service Level Agreements: https://www.libreoffice.org/download/libreoffice-in-business/.

LibreOffice Community and the LibreOffice Enterprise family of products are based on the LibreOffice Technology platform, the result of years of development efforts with the objective of providing a state of the art office suite not only for the desktop but also for mobile and the cloud.

Products based on LibreOffice Technology are available for major desktop operating systems (Windows, macOS, Linux and Chrome OS), mobile platforms (Android and iOS) and the cloud. They may have a different name, according to each company brand strategy, but they share the same LibreOffice unique advantages, robustness and flexibility.

Availability of LibreOffice 7.3.3 Community

LibreOffice 7.3.3 Community represents the bleeding edge in term of features for open source office suites. For users whose main objective is personal productivity and therefore prefer a release that has undergone more testing and bug fixing over the new features, The Document Foundation provides LibreOffice 7.2.6 and soon LibreOffice 7.2.7.

LibreOffice 7.3.3 change log pages are available on TDF’s wiki: https://wiki.documentfoundation.org/Releases/7.3.3/RC1 (changed in RC1) and https://wiki.documentfoundation.org/Releases/7.3.3/RC2 (changed in RC2). Over 80 bugs and regressions have been solved.

LibreOffice Technology based products for Android and iOS are listed here: https://www.libreoffice.org/download/android-and-ios/, while for App Stores and ChromeOS are listed here: https://www.libreoffice.org/download/libreoffice-from-microsoft-and-mac-app-stores/

LibreOffice individual users are assisted by a global community of volunteers: https://www.libreoffice.org/get-help/community-support/. On the website and the wiki there are guides, manuals, tutorials and HowTos. Donations help the project to make all of these resources available.

LibreOffice users are invited to join the community at https://ask.libreoffice.org, where they can get and provide user-to-user support. People willing to contribute their time and professional skills to the project can visit the dedicated website at https://whatcanidoforlibreoffice.org.

LibreOffice users, free software advocates and community members can provide financial support to The Document Foundation with a donation via PayPal, credit card or other tools at https://www.libreoffice.org/donate.

LibreOffice 7.3.3 is built with document conversion libraries from the Document Liberation Project: https://www.documentliberation.org.

LibreOffice project and community recap: April 2022

Here’s our summary of updates, events and activities in the LibreOffice project in the last four weeks – click the links to learn more…

  • How do different free and open source software projects do mentorship, and how can we all learn from each other? Daniel Garcia Moreno (EndlessOS Foundation and GNOME), Emily Gonyer (openSUSE), Ilmari Lauhakangas (The Document Foundation), and Marie Nordin (Fedora) discuss this in a panel moderated by Ben Cotton:

Please confirm that you want to play a YouTube video. By accepting, you will be accessing content from YouTube, a service provided by an external third party.

YouTube privacy policy

If you accept this notice, your choice will be saved and the page will refresh.

Keep in touch – follow us on Twitter, Facebook and Mastodon. Like what we do? Support our community with a donation – or join us and help to make LibreOffice even better!